These mini taco bites are a perfect addition to your Taco Thursday menu. They are fun, flavorful, and easy to make. Serve them as appetizers or a tasty snack!
Ingredients: 1 pound ground beef. 1 packet taco seasoning mix. 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ese. 1/2 cup diced tomatoes. 1/4 cup diced red onions. 1/4 cup sliced black olives. 1/4 cup chopped fresh cilantro. 24 mini flour tortillas. Cooking spray.
Instructions: Start by heating the oven to 350F 175C. Put the ground beef in a pan and cook it over medium-low heat until it turns brown and is fully cooked. Remove any extra grease. To season the beef, add the taco seasoning mix and do what it says on the package. Most of the time, you'll need to add water and let the mixture cook until it gets thick. Use cooking spray on a cupcake tin. You can use a round cookie cutter or a cup that fits the holes in your cupcake tin to cut circles out of the mini flour tortillas. To make a mini taco shell, press each tortilla circle into the hole in a cupcake tin. Put some of the seasoned ground beef into each taco shell. Add shredded cheddar cheese to the top of the mini tacos. Put it in an oven that is already hot and bake for 10 to 12 minutes, or until the cheese melts and bubbles. Take the taco bites out of the oven and let them cool down a bit. Put black olives, diced tomatoes, red onions, and chopped cilantro on top of the dish. Enjoy your warm mini taco bites!
Prep Time: 15 minutes
Cook Time: 12 minutes
